How they compare
Malawi currently reports 206,706 against 142,038 in Burundi, a difference of 64,668.
That makes Malawi's figure about 1.5 times Burundi's.
Across all 34 years both countries report, Malawi has been ahead every year.
Burundi ranks 8th and Malawi ranks 5th of 203 countries.
Malawi has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Burundi | Malawi |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 4,446 | 19,988 | 15,541 | Malawi |
| 1980s | 9,892 | 28,562 | 18,670 | Malawi |
| 1990s | 20,673 | 51,818 | 31,146 | Malawi |
| 2000s | 64,725 | 112,553 | 47,828 | Malawi |
| 2010s | 116,464 | 152,870 | 36,406 | Malawi |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
